李松 何俊
(武漢船用電力推進裝置研究所,武漢 430064)
X62W萬能銑床是一種高效率的加工機械,在機械加工和機械修理中得到廣泛的應用[1]。萬能銑床的操作,是通過手柄同時操作電氣與機械,以達到機電緊密配合完成預定的操作,是機械與電氣結構聯合動作的典型控制,自動化程度較高。但是在電氣控制系統(tǒng)中,故障的查找與排除非常困難,給生產與維護帶來諸多不便,嚴重地影響生產。隨著工業(yè)自動化的發(fā)展,對工業(yè)智能化程度的要求越來越高,以及市場經濟要求制造業(yè)對市場需求做出迅速反應—生產出小批量、多品種、多規(guī)格、低成本和高質量的產品。為滿足這一要求,生產設備和自動生產線的控制系統(tǒng)必需具有極高的可靠性與靈活性,這就需要使用智能化程度高的控制系統(tǒng)來取代傳統(tǒng)的控制系統(tǒng),使電氣控制系統(tǒng)的工作更加靈活、可靠,更容易維修,更能適應經常變動的工藝條件。針對這些問題,本文提出了利用西門子S7-200[2]和觸摸屏對X62W型臥式萬能銑床的繼電接觸式電控系統(tǒng)進行技術改造[3,4]的方案。
主電路中有三臺電動機,M1是主電動機,拖動主軸帶動銑刀進行銑削加工;M2是進給電動機,拖動升降臺及工作臺進給;M3是冷卻泵電動機,供應冷卻液。三臺電動機共用一組熔斷器FU1作短路保護。每臺電動機均有熱繼電器FR作過載保護。其中以主電動機的熱繼電器 FU1和冷卻泵電機的熱繼電器FU2作總的保護,它們的常閉觸頭串在控制電路的總線上,而進給電動機的熱繼電器FR3只作進給系統(tǒng)的保護,其常閉觸頭接在進給控制電路中。主電動機要求不頻繁的正反轉,用組合開關SA5控制倒相。進給電動機的正反轉頻繁,用接觸器KM3和KM4進行倒相。冷卻泵在主電動機起動后方可開動,另有手動開關SA1控制。主電機采用兩組起動按鈕SB3和SB4并聯,兩組停止按鈕SB1和SB2串聯。接觸器KM1是電動機M1的控制接觸器,SQ7是位置開關,用作主軸變速的沖動開關。主軸的起動,按下起動按鈕 SB3或 SB4,接觸器KM1通電吸合并自鎖,主電動機M1起動。當主電動機起動后,KM1的輔助觸頭接通控制電路的進給控制部分,才可以開動進給電動機。電機的轉速達到一定速度時接通速度繼電器,當按下停止按鈕SB1或SB2時,接觸器KM2得電,主軸電機反轉。
圖1 PLC 外接硬件電路
工作臺向右進給,當主軸起動后,工作臺控制電源接通。將位置開關SQ1旋轉,SQ1-1 常開觸頭閉合,接觸器KM3通電吸合,電動機M2正轉。當運行到預定位置時,位置開關SQ1復位,電動機M2停止轉動。工作臺向左進給,將位置開關SQ2旋轉,SQ2-1閉合,SQ2-2斷開,接觸器KM4通電吸合,電動機反轉,工作臺向左移動。不論電動機正反轉,接觸器 KM3和 KM4的線圈電流都由SQ1-2和SQ3-2接通。若機床正在向左進給機床的聯鎖問題,當SQ2或SQ4被旋轉時,它們的常閉觸頭SQ2-2或SQ4-2是斷開的,向左或向右進給時,發(fā)生誤操作,壓著上下前后手柄,則一定使SQ3-2或SQ4-2中的一個斷開,使KM3或KM4斷電釋放,電動機M2停止運轉,以確保安全。位置開關SQ6為進給變速沖動開關。冷卻和照明控制,冷卻泵只有在主電動機起動后才能起動,所以主電路中將M3接在主接觸器KM1觸頭后面,SA1控制冷卻泵。照明電路用安全電壓36 V用開關SA4 控制。
根據X62W萬能銑床電氣控制要求,輸入輸出均為開關量,需要PLC監(jiān)測[5]的輸入信號有8個按鈕,5個行程開關,兩個選擇開關,輸入點為21點,PLC 輸出控制信號有6個繼電器,1個照明燈,共7點。因此,選用了西門子S7-200PLC,具體配 置如下 : CPU226CN AC/DC/DC 型(6ES7 216-2BD23- 0XB8), 自帶24點輸入,16點輸出,自帶兩個接口2個RS-485 接口PORT0和POT1,一個通訊接口,能滿足控制要求。PLC的I/O口分配是根據其控制對象的特點和控制要求,將I/O口的輸入輸出口與相應的電氣設備相連,達到控制和檢測的功能,具體I/O分配如表1。進行完I/O分配后,進行PLC硬件設計,PLC外接硬件電路如圖1。
根據機床控制要求,PLC語句表用6 個內部輔助繼電器來簡化程序設計,主軸電機正反轉互鎖和進給電機正反轉互鎖提高了系統(tǒng)運行的可靠性。在程序中將不同的控制方式分開設計,這樣程序結構簡潔、清晰。由于整個系統(tǒng)用觸摸屏控制,它可替代物理按鈕和開關及其指示燈,所以在編程序是這些按鈕和開關均使用了內部寄存器M0.6-M3.1,把下面程序的輸入寄存器改成相應的內部寄存器即可。
觸摸屏越來越多的用在了工業(yè)中,方便,易于遠程控制。根據 X62W 銑床的控制要求,我們用NTOUCH觸摸屏和MCGS組態(tài)軟件配合PLC來替代控制柜上的按鈕和選擇開關等物理元器件,并且還可以通過觸摸屏來監(jiān)視銑床運行動作情況。
通過對系統(tǒng)的分析,在本系統(tǒng)中,依靠MCGS系統(tǒng)設計組態(tài)畫面,實現對系統(tǒng)操作和監(jiān)控。以上提到此系統(tǒng)的輸入和輸出均是開關量,所以在MCGS組態(tài)的實時數據庫中定義的名字類型也要為開關型的,如表1。
表1 實時數據庫
MCGS組態(tài)軟件在設備窗口中建立系統(tǒng)與外部硬件設備的連接關系,使系統(tǒng)能夠從外部設備讀取數據并控制外部設備的工作狀態(tài),實現對工業(yè)過程的實時監(jiān)控。根據此系統(tǒng)的控制要求及控制方式,可利用PPI電纜,相互傳數據,以便實現監(jiān)控。
在設備窗口中需要設置設備 0-[通用串行口父設備]屬性和設備1-[西門子S7-200PPI]屬性。此時,還需要設置設備內部屬性增加相應的PLC通道,和通道讀寫類型。輸入通道多數用到的是內部寄存器,讀寫類型是只讀類型。輸出寄存器Q0.0~Q0.6,Q1.0和Q1.1讀寫類型為只讀類型值,讀取SA313和SA32的開關信號。在實際通訊過程中,在設備屬性設置中“串口端口號”設為COM1,通訊波特率設為: 9600;數據位位數:3-8位;數據校驗方式:偶校驗,一位停止位;數據采集方式:同步采集。設置完后單擊“確認”按鈕返回。
為了西門子S7-200PLC與MCGS更好地通訊,必須在設備屬性設置:[設備1]對話框中設置屬性設備注釋為:西門子 S7-200PPI;初始工作狀態(tài)為:啟動;最小采樣周期為:1000 ms;PLC地址為:2。內部屬性設置 PLC通道要與實施數據庫中所定義的名字相對應。如圖2。
圖2 PLC通道屬性設置
編輯完畢組態(tài)畫面,在上位機上試驗成功,便可以通過上位機的網線接口用一根網線和觸摸屏上的網線接口相連接。然后,用PPI電纜連接觸摸屏和PLC,母頭連接觸摸屏COM5口,公頭連接在PLC接口上,即可實現丟掉控制柜面板上的按鈕控制,用觸摸屏的軟按鈕控制,畫面生動,清晰。
本文所述方案是對原來的繼電接觸式模擬控制系統(tǒng)進行PLC與觸摸屏改造而成,已在實驗室控制柜予以實施。運行結果表明,該 PLC 控制系統(tǒng)無論是硬件還是軟件,控制穩(wěn)定可靠,且盡大限度降低了操作的危險性。
[1]吳承彪, 徐建華. X62W萬能銑床進給變速部分的改進[J]. 制造技術與機床, 1998, 25(18): 18-22.
[2]趙景波(譯). 西門子S7-200 [M]. 北京: 機械工業(yè)出版社, 2010.
[3]陳遠齡. 機床電氣自動控制[M]. 重慶: 重慶大學出版社, 1997 .
[4]呂景泉. 可編程序控制器及其應用[M]. 北京: 機械工業(yè)出版社, 2010 .
[5]張凱, 黃真. 普通銑床的 PLC改造方法[J]. 裝備制造技術, 2011, 5(11): 33-37.